2012 85kW Black Tesla Model S rear-wheel drive with ~97,000 miles, early VIN, single owner
  • Unlimited Lifetime Supercharging
  • 8-Year unlimited mileage Drive Unit warranty
  • 8-Year unlimited mileage battery warranty
  • Lifetime free 3G connectivity
  • Has XM available (most solid roof Model S do not)
  • Solid roof
  • Dual Chargers (up to 80 amps/20kW/60 mph charging)
  • Tan leather Interior with Lacewood trim
  • Tech Package (but no auto-pilot, parking sensors, etc.)
  • Heated front seats
  • Premium audio
  • Remote rear hatch
  • Large Frunk with storage container that fits in the “microwave space”
  • No rear-facing seat
  • Extra set of OEM 19” rims with winter tires mounted
  • Aftermarket center storage console
  • Aftermarket underscreen drawer
  • Aftermarket stainless steel pedals and dead pedal
  • 40 amp/10kW/30mph Mobile Charger with NEMA 14-50 and 120v adapters
  • Aftermarket BlackVue dual camera dash camera ($200 extra)
  • Window tint all around except windshield
  • Air Suspension
  • Some trim features now only available on performance upgraded models
  • Full charge rated range currently ~250miles
  • 90% (daily) charge ~220 miles
  • Had 96,000 mile service in the past 2 months
  • Has had the drive motor replaced, several door handles replaced, headliner and windshield replaced. Many “early adopter” bugs and quirks fixed.
  • Still drives like a dream, real world 0-60 is about 5 seconds.

$37,500 Located in Nixa, Missouri, can discuss shipping vs. pickup.
